Abstract

The article characterizes activities of Archimandrite Antonin (Kapustin) in the aspect of his collecting and archeographic work, in particular his studies of a Zion codex of the Bible on Athos, composition of a systematic catalog of manuscripts of the dwelling of St. Great Martyr Ekaterina, a catalog of manuscripts of the library of Jerusalem Saint Grave Yard in Constantinople, preparation to the publication of acts of the Russian St. Panteleimon Monastery on Athos, etc. The Archimandrite’s memoirs are analyzed as a source on his bibliophilic interests. The contents and composition of the gifts donated by the Archimandrite as a benefactor to the Kyiv Ecclesiastical Academy are presented, in particular a collection of ancient Greek and Slavonic manuscripts on parchment and paper, various pictures and photographs, a collection of ancient Greek and Roman coins, etc. are described. A range of people, who connected p. Antonin with Kyiv, is defined. The destiny of his book and manuscript heritage is traced.
